To support our extraordinary teams who build great products and contribute to our growth, we’re looking to add a Global Industrial & Systems Engineers located in Prai, Penang.
Provides process time estimation to the quote team.
Simulates process, materials and manufacturing workflow and gives input to process engineer by using REFA, MOST, WITNESS and or adequate tools.
During NPI coordinates process planning and set up with respect to takt, cycle time and direct labor requirement.
Reviews result during protyping and trial runs and gives feedback to NPI and sales team.
Work measurement programs and examines work samples to develop standards for labor utilization.
Examines staff utilization, facility layout, and operational data, such as production costs, process flow charts, and production schedules, to define efficient utilization of workers and equipment.
Recommends methods for improving worker efficiency and reducing waste of materials and utilities, such as restructuring job duties, reorganizing work flow, relocation work stations and equipment, and purchase of equipment.
Confers with management and engineering staff to implement plans and recommendations.
May develop management systems for cost reviews, financial planning, wage and salary administration, and job evaluation.
Develops management control systems to aid in financial planning and cost reviews, and design production planning and control systems to coordinate activities and ensure product quality.
Designs or improve systems for the physical distribution of goods and services, as well as defining the most efficient plant locations.
Manages and supports initiatives to increase throughput, reduce cost and improve performance in constrained areas like Lean, Automation and/or Six Sigma projects.
